I recently downloaded Autodesk CFD (2023 version on windows 10) and have a problem with my viewport. It seems to be shifted from the top right corner (visible by the black border on the right of the viewport and at the top). Due to this, my mouse is also misaligned which makes selecting parts really difficult, as well as using the view cube and navigation bar. The mouse misalignment is the worst in the vertical movement (mouse icon is about 1 cm higher than it should be). The horizontal movement seems not to be misaligned.
I only have this misalignment problem in the viewport itself. The mouse interacts with the rest of the CFD program without any problem.
Does anyone know how to solve this issue? I have already tried to reboot my computer as well as reinstalling Autodesk CFD.

I also discovered that if the file is already open with the viewport misaligned, you can drag the whole app window to the main monitor, then in View, change the viewport to another style, then back and that will realign without having to close and reopen CFD.
